Understanding Gasket Seals
Before delving into replacement procedures, it's vital to comprehend what gasket seals are and how they function.
What is a Gasket Seal?
A gasket seal is a mechanical seal that fills the space in between two or more mating surfaces in order to prevent leakage of fluids or gases during operation. They can be made from various products, consisting of rubber, cork, metal, and composite products, each fit for particular applications and conditions.

Changing a gasket seal may seem complicated, however it can be workable with the right tools and approach. Here's a detailed guide:
Tools and Materials NeededNew gasket seal (particular to the application)Gasket scraper or razor bladeTidy fabrics or ragsGasket sealant (if needed)Torque wrenchSocket set and wrenchScrewdriversSecurity gloves and safety glassesReplacement Steps
Preparation
Disconnect power sources (for electrical systems) and drain pipes any fluids if essential.
Accessing the Gasket
Eliminate any components that obstruct access to the Vinyl Gasket Replacement. This may include pipelines, covers, or other fixtures.
Eliminating the Old Gasket
Use a gasket scraper or razor blade to thoroughly get rid of the old gasket product. Beware not to scratch the mating surfaces.
Cleaning the Surfaces
Clean the breeding surfaces thoroughly with a cloth to eliminate particles, oil, or leftover adhesive. Guarantee they are totally dry before continuing.
Setting Up the New Gasket
Place the brand-new gasket onto the tidy surface area. If the manufacturer recommends a sealant, apply a thin layer according to directions.
Reassembling the Components
Reattach any elements that were gotten rid of in the primary step. Use a torque wrench to guarantee that bolts are tightened up to the manufacturer's specifications. Doing this in a crisscross pattern can help distribute pressure uniformly.
Final Check
Double-check all connections and make sure everything is safe. Reconnect any source of power or pipes.
Evaluating
